So, this winter has been rough on my throat; but the past two weeks have been almost unbearable! This winter I’ve had 6 bad sore throats, 3 of them being strep. My doctor thinks I’m a strep-carrier and that I would be ailed with them time after time. After much thought, we decided to go ahead and get my tonsils out. The E.N.T. kept saying, '”Are you sure? It’s really a bad recovery.” I assured him getting sick every few weeks is no picnic either. He agreed it needed to be done, but was still leery of doing it—I can see why now! I totally underestimated how bad of a surgery/recovery it is to have a tonsillectomy as an adult. It was bad the first few days, but I was naïve as to how much worse it was going to get. Last weekend hit it’s peak, I woke up with bloody scabs falling off and my throat was basically open wounds. Even full doses of all my meds haven’t been taking the pain away—but how grateful I am for medicine!
